Hello all.

Boo had to go to the vet today. He came home yesterday with a lump on his underside. It turns out that he had been in a fight, with another cat. It had become infected. I got concerned and in he went to see his vet. The vet found the infection. It wasnt very large but, it looked pretty ugly.

Boo, is usually kept indoors at night because a majority of the cat fights happen at night. The vet prescribed a antibiotic that he takes for seven days. I thought hmm that anitbiotic is exactly the same one that I have had to take for my infections. Only in people dose.

The vet didnt stich him up but, said to keep him inside and, use the antibiotic and all he will have is a scar but, none the less worse for wear. I am so glad that he is caught up on his shots. I know the cat that he got into it with doesnt have a owner.

I would like to see him picked up by animal controll but they dont pick up cats. He has become such a pain in the butt. And, is costing my other neighbours vet bills as well. We, all now have to keep our cats inside just to make sure that he doesnt attack.


I just have to make sure that Boo does not make a mad dash for the door he is pretty quick but while he is healing he doenst seem to interested in going anywhere but to sleep.
